In what is set to become a major milestone achievement in its 50 years of existence, the Lagos State Government on Wednesday sign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) to kick-start the construction of the 38km 4th Mainland Bridge, expected to bring a 14-year old dream to reality. The Bridge, which is geared towards economic growth in the State, is expected to gulp N844billion in a Public Private Partnership (PPP) initiative and would be delivered in three years. Edo State Government has withdrawn a letter earlier issued on the Oba of Benin, saying it was issued in error. The Federal Government has appointed new heads for Nigeria Telelevision Authority (NTA), Voice of Nigeria (VON), Federal Radio Corporation of Nigeria (FRCN),News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) National Orientation Agency (NOA) and Nigerian Broadcasting Commission (NBC). A satement released by Special Adviser to the minister of Information and Culture, Segun Adeyemi, said Alhaji Lai Mohammed announced the appointments in Wednesday. Oando a major player in the downstream sector of the oil industry with a vast network of infrastructure and large distribution footprint, says it will take advantage of opportunities offered by the recent review of petrol pump price to boost its activities. The company said it will be able to leverage on its strong export trading business and achieve operational efficiencies through economies of scale. Oando said it is more significantly positioned to gain strong financial control with the elimination of fixed allocations and petroleum subsidies, to essentially improve its revenue base, cash flows and subsequently its bottom line. South Africa’s navy has detained three Chinese ships with around 100 crew on board on suspicion of illegal squid fishing, officials said. The ships were spotted on Friday having entered South Africa’s 200 nautical mile economic exclusion zone without permits. Climate activists seeking to pull investors into their camp are pushing Exxon Mobil and Chevron to limit money spent on exploration in favour of higher dividends and more share buybacks. Shareholders will vote Wednesday on proposals that would urge the two biggest US oil producers to cut what they spend opening up new oil fields and instead hand the money to investors. Environmental critics say future climate rules will soon make it unprofitable to pump. African governments must take urgent steps to ensure they can finance their debt after borrowing heavily in recent years when interest rates were low, the head of the African Development Bank (AfDB) had  said. “Increasingly many African countries, taking advantage of the low global interest rates, have rushed to international capital markets by issuing bonds,” Akinwumi Adesina said in a statement. He said they now faced a challenge with rising interest rates.
